Runbook: Meridly calendar sync conflict. When two-way sync with Pagefeather calendars double-books, the reconciler in sync-worker picks the older event and drops the rest. Reviewers: check dedupe key logic in conflict.go before approving. To reproduce locally, run the worker against the staging tenant with a fresh .env. Add the sync token line below to your .env first.

secret setting of hawep-yahig: LEDGER_TOKEN29=41b5d6315371c92885eaeb077fb63

// Broker upgrade notes for plugin authors:
// Quillbus 4.x replaces the legacy 3.x wire protocol. Plugins must
// construct the client with explicit protocol negotiation enabled,
// or connections to the Larkfield cluster will be silently downgraded
// and dropped after 30s. Topic names are unchanged. For local testing
// against the sandbox broker, authenticate with the key below.

API key for bafof-bagaf: qvz2-qi

Handover note — from Director Ilsa Renholt to Director Marek Voss

For the sales leads: the Quillstone marketing budget reduction takes effect next month. Trade-show presence narrows to Harrowgate only; digital retargeting continues at reduced spend. Pipeline targets remain unchanged, so brief your teams carefully on messaging. The confidential rationale for the board follows below.

management briefing: The renewal with Quenathox Group closes at $10 million a year, 20 percent below the last contract. Project Ulawyn slips by two quarters because of the supplier delay.